Wolverine / Punisher #2
In "The Lady, the Atheist and the Demon," Wolverine and the Punisher clash in a tense standoff before converging on the lawless city of Erewhon, a haven for the criminal elite. As its leaders vie for the chance to execute the Punisher, Wolverine makes a sudden departure—leaving with the enigmatic Lady, whose true motives remain shrouded in mystery. Written by Peter Milligan and illustrated by Lee Weeks, with inks by Tom Palmer, colors by Dean White, and letters by Randy Gentile, the issue’s cover by Gary Frank captures the gritty intensity of the clash.
